MA in Sustainable Energy Topic Areas


  • Technology and Innovation Emerging renewable energy technologies, including artificial intelligence, smart grids, and scalable clean energy solutions
  • Markets and Economic Analysis Advanced quantitative methods for evaluating energy markets and assessing investment opportunities
  • Finance and Investment Project finance, climate finance, and sustainable investment strategies in global energy markets
  • Policy and Regulation Market-based policies, energy regulations, and policy instruments shaping the global energy transition
  • Climate and Environment Strategies for decarbonization, carbon markets, energy transition, and environmental sustainability across the energy sector

Sustainable Energy Career Outlook

As global leaders push for clean energy solutions, demand for professionals skilled in strategy, governance, and policy continues to grow.

The world will add more than 5,500 gigawatts of new renewable energy capacity between 2024 and 2030, almost three times the increase seen between 2017 and 2023 (IEA). In the US alone, clean energy jobs grew at more than twice the rate of overall employment in 2024 (DOE).

Graduates of the MA in Sustainable Energy program capitalize on these opportunities. Our record speaks for itself: 100% of our sustainable energy graduates from our class of 2022 secured positions in industry, fellowships, or advanced education within six months of graduation.

SAIS Career Services provides personalized job search assistance, one-on-one career coaching, targeted interview preparation, and invitations to DC-area events, including career treks, pitch competitions, and high-level networking opportunities.

We have extensive recruitment channels, with nearly 200 employers visiting Johns Hopkins in person and online annually to present their organizations and recruitment processes.

JHU also offers more than 35 job skills courses annually that focus on highly marketable skills such as intros to R or Python, project management, crafting your “elevator pitch,” getting a security clearance, and more. These courses are completely free for current students and alumni, with most held on campus and some available online.
